Defining Success and Failure in the Mercato

Measuring the success of a club's transfer spending isn't simply about the amount invested. While a massive dépense mercato might grab headlines, true success is measured by:

  • On-field performance: Did the new signings significantly improve the team's league position, cup runs, or European performance?
  • Return on investment: Did the players justify their transfer fees through goals, assists, and overall team contribution? This is often difficult to quantify immediately.
  • Long-term impact: Did the signings integrate well into the squad, developing their skills and increasing their market value over time?
  • Squad harmony: Did the new acquisitions disrupt the existing team dynamic or improve it?

A club might spend heavily and achieve short-term success, but ultimately fail to build a sustainable, long-term project. Conversely, shrewd spending can yield remarkable results.

Top Dépenses Mercato Clubs: A Closer Look

Some clubs consistently rank among the highest spenders. However, their success varies dramatically. Analyzing these clubs requires a nuanced approach, going beyond simple financial figures. For example:

  • Manchester City: Consistently among the top dépenses mercato clubs, City's success is undeniable, with multiple Premier League titles and Champions League success. Their strategy combines strategic recruitment with a focus on building a strong squad depth.
  • Paris Saint-Germain: PSG's immense spending has brought them domestic dominance in France, but their Champions League performance has often fallen short of expectations, highlighting the limitations of simply buying success.
  • Chelsea: Chelsea's spending patterns have fluctuated under different ownerships, with periods of significant investment followed by periods of relative restraint. Evaluating their success requires considering the context of their managerial changes and squad rebuilding phases.
  • Real Madrid: Real Madrid's spending is often strategic, focused on acquiring world-class talent capable of impacting major matches. Their success is closely linked to their ability to manage the squad's dynamics and ensure seamless integration of new signings.

Flop Dépenses Mercato Clubs: Lessons Learned

Analyzing clubs that haven't seen a return on their significant dépenses mercato offers valuable lessons:

  • Lack of cohesive strategy: Investing heavily without a clear vision for how new players will fit into the existing system often leads to disappointment.
  • Overpaying for players: Inflated transfer fees can cripple a club's finances and put undue pressure on players to perform.
  • Poor scouting and recruitment: Failure to identify players who are a good fit for the team's style of play, or who have the necessary mental fortitude to succeed at the highest level, can significantly impact results.
  • Ignoring team chemistry: A squad is more than the sum of its parts. Recruiting players who don't mesh well can create conflicts and undermine team performance.
